In this episode of The Med-Legal Green Room, host Sam Frentzas interviews Dr. Nelson Hendler, Founder and Chairman of Pain Diagnostics, LLC. Dr. Hendler, former assistant professor of neurosurgery at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ine and past president of the American Academy of Pain Management, is a pioneering pain medicine physician. He discusses why diagnoses are commonly missed in accident patients, citing time-pressured physicians and inadequate diagnostic testing. He also highlights how standard imaging like MRIs frequently miss critical pathologies and explains the importance of physiological testing over anatomical imaging. Dr. Hendler introduces his innovative diagnostic tools, including the Pain Validity Test and Diagnostic Paradigm, which utilize Bayesian logic and artificial intelligence to achieve a 96% correlation with Johns Hopkins diagnoses, revolutionizing chronic pain diagnosis for accident victims.
